VH is a variant of the Fridrich method, which orients the last-layer edges during insertion of the final F2L block. It has exactly the same effect as the ZBF2L stage of the ZB method, but uses much fewer algorithms - 32 as opposed to ZBF2L's 125 (excluding mirror's and inverses). It achieves this by restricting the LL orientation step to the moment before insertion of the final 1x1x2 block (in a similar manner to Winter Variation). With full ZBF2L, LL orientation is carried out from any F2L last slot case.
